Transaction e585ffe1346c4057e18173fc6fbf86207edaa49e7e424438aa258641356ec41c
1 Input
1 Output
-
e585ffe1346c4057e18173fc6fbf86207edaa49e7e424438aa258641356ec41c:0
- value
- 24576335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b232d9b1743c6832533874299ed1adcc29d32602 OP_EQUAL
- address
- 3HwF7qNWpiiRGW11Cfbj1N89egnFvgyWp9